Glaetzle, Igor Lesanovsky, Rejish Nath, Weibin Li","submitted_at":"2012-08-14T13:50:21Z","abstract_excerpt":"We present a mechanism that permits the parallel execution of multiple quantum gate operations within a single long linear ion chain. Our approach is based on large coherent forces that occur when ions are electronically excited to long-lived Rydberg states. The presence of Rydberg ions drastically affects the vibrational mode structure of the ion crystal giving rise to modes that are spatially localized on isolated sub-crystals which can be individually and independently manipulated.
